Transaction 060696351830e8063b70292becfb0b828dac33d86f5a4aff2b26d6099d3aeb42
1 Input
1 Output
-
060696351830e8063b70292becfb0b828dac33d86f5a4aff2b26d6099d3aeb42:0
- value
- 3870878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da43518570d1881b4e37b2a4c209bd03fd7c86ac OP_EQUAL
- address
- 3Mb5sjJX8ckcP3p4pDtQumXbN6VptKht6U